The Secret of the Safe
The silence in the parlor became deafening. The furious matriarch, who only moments ago seemed ready to drown Chloe for a handful of missing gold, looked as though she had been struck by lightning. Her face paled, the deep lines of her anger smoothing out into sheer panic. She reached out a trembling hand to snatch the paper, but Chloe instinctively stepped back, clutching the document tightly to her damp chest.
"Give that to me, Chloe!" Margaret demanded, though her voice lacked its previous venom, replaced instead by a desperate, cracking plea. "It’s none of your business. It's old family trash!"
But Chloe was already reading the text printed under the official seal. The mother's name was listed as Sarah Vance, Margaret's late daughter-in-law. But it was the father’s name that made Chloe's heart stop: Julian Vance, Margaret’s beloved son who had tragically passed away twenty-three years ago. Most shocking of all was the baby's name on the registry—it was Chloe. All her life, Margaret had told Chloe that she was merely a charity case, an orphan found on the streets whom Margaret had taken in out of the goodness of her heart. In reality, Chloe was Margaret's biological granddaughter.
Eleanor finally stepped forward, her anxious demeanor giving way to a flood of tears. She looked at Margaret, then at Chloe, her voice filled with decades of built-up guilt.
"I told you we couldn't keep this from her forever, Mother," Eleanor sobbed, covering her face. "She had a right to know who her father was. She had a right to her inheritance!"
The puzzle pieces fell into place with agonizing clarity. The "missing gold" Margaret had been obsessing over was never stolen by Chloe. Margaret had simply misplaced her own stash in her declining mental state, but her deep-seated guilt and paranoia had driven her to accuse Chloe, desperate for an excuse to kick the young woman out before the truth of her lineage was ever discovered.
